How Our Sump Pump Overflow Water Removal Process Works

When you call us for sump pump overflow water removal, our team springs into action. We'll arrive within 60 minutes to assess the damage and start the cleanup process. Our crew is equipped with the latest equipment, including truck-mounted extractors and dehumidifiers, to get your home dry and safe in no time.

Step 1: Assessment and Preparation

Our team will arrive at your home and assess the damage. We'll identify the source of the leak and find out the best course of action to get your home dry and safe. We'll also take photos and document the damage for insurance purposes.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Using our truck-mounted extractor, we'll remove the standing water from your home. This is the most critical step in the process, as it prevents further damage and reduces the risk of mold and mildew growth.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been extracted, our team will use dehumidifiers to dry out your home. This is an essential step to prevent mold and mildew growth and to ensure your home is safe and healthy.

Step 4: Cleaning and Restoration

With your home dry and safe, our team will begin the cleaning and restoration process. We'll remove any damaged materials, clean and disinfect the affected areas, and restore your home to its original condition.

Sump Pump Overflow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water leak in a contained area Yes No Easy to clean up and repair yourself.
Large water leak or flood No Yes Needs specialized equipment and expertise to clean up and restore safely.
Water damage to a load-bearing wall or structural element No Yes Needs specialized expertise to ensure safe and proper repair.
Water damage to a home with a history of water issues No Yes Needs specialized expertise to identify and address underlying issues.
Water damage to a home with sensitive or irreplaceable items No Yes Needs specialized care and handling to ensure safe and proper restoration.

Sump Pump Overflow Water Removal Cost in Santee, SC

The cost of sump pump overflow water removal var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Santee, SC. Here are some estimated price ranges for different services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 - $2,500 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Cleaning and restoration $1,000 - $5,000 Severity of damage, type of materials affected
Dehumidification and drying $500 - $2,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Repair or replacement of damaged materials $500 - $5,000 Type of materials affected, complexity of repair
Inspection and assessment $100 - $500 Severity of damage, complexity of assessment
